When isel is emitting instructions for an x86 target without CMOV, the CFG is
edited during emission. If the basic block ends in a switch that gets lowered to a jump table, any phis at the default edge were getting updated wrong. The jump table data structure keeps a pointer to the header blocks that wasn't getting updated after the MBB is split. This bug was exposed on 32-bit Linux when disabling critical edge splitting in codegen prepare. The fix is to uipdate stale MBB pointers whenever a block is split during emission. git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@115191 91177308-0d34-0410-b5e6-96231b3b80d8

+void SelectionDAGBuilder::UpdateSplitBlock(MachineBasicBlock *First,
+ MachineBasicBlock *Last) {
+ // Update JTCases.
+ for (unsigned i = 0, e = JTCases.size(); i != e; ++i)
+ if (JTCases[i].first.HeaderBB == First)
+ JTCases[i].first.HeaderBB = Last;
+
+ // Update BitTestCases.
+ for (unsigned i = 0, e = BitTestCases.size(); i != e; ++i)
+ if (BitTestCases[i].Parent == First)
+ BitTestCases[i].Parent = Last;
+}
